摘要: 以紫外诱变和化学诱变相结合的复合诱变方法,对γ-癸内酯产生菌株Yarrowia lipolytica酵母进行诱变。经过一次紫外诱变后,γ-癸内酯产量为过去的2.5倍,但多次诱变后其产量并没有进一步提高,且稳定性不好。其后采用硫酸二乙酯进行化学诱变稳定其产量。最终γ-癸内酯产量为出发菌株的2.3倍。

Abstract: A strain for producing γ-decanolactone was obtained by composite mutation (ultraviolet mutation and chemical mutation). After the first ultraviolet mutation, the yield of γ-decanolactone was as 2.5 times as the original strain. But the yield was not stability and didn’t have further increase after more mutations. At last diethyl sulfate stabilized the yield, and it was increased by 2.3 times.
